Hot Food Takeaway/Sui Generis Lease Disposal 52 Rodney Street, Edinburgh EH7 4DX LOCATION The subject property is situated north easterly on Rodney Street approximately 1 mile north of Princes Street. The Broughton area of Edinburgh connects with Leith, the Newtown, and Canonmills. The unit sits near the corner of Herriot Hill Terrace and is surrounded by a mix of residential tenements, retailers, restaurants, cafes and bars. The amount of passing traffic and trade make this a popular commercial destination. Public transport links are very good with regular bus routes stopping close to the property. The tram stops at the top of Broughton Street just a 10 minute walk from the premises. DESCRIPTION The subjects are configured over the ground floor and comprise a single windowed retail unit, with three floors of residential properties above. Fully kitted out to suit any restaurant/takeaway style business, the shop benefits from an open plan sales/seating area to the front with waiting area and opens to the back open plan kitchen are fully fitted stainless steel and a large extraction canopy with cooking equipment such as cookers, fryers fridges etc... There are high level storage solutions, and the rear right of the ground floor is the staff WC, there is also a WC for customers in the middle of the unit between front shop and back shop. The unit is used as a Thai BYOB restaurant/takeaway currently and has a strong following from locals, the seating area is cosy with mood lighting and suits the space well other features include gas combi boiler, Cooking Equipment, Fridges and freezers, Stainless Steel Sinks etc…. ACCOMMODATION According to our recent measurement survey the subject comprises the following approximate net internal area: Ground Floor: 57 SQ M (614 SQ FT) RENT & PREMIUM The rent is currently £15,000 per annum A premium of £42,000 is sought. LEASE TERMS AND THE BUSINESS The lease has approximately 9.5 years remaining on full repairing and insuring conditions. The business has excellent google reviews and is fully booked most weekends as well as having a delivery service RATEABLE VALUE According to the Scottish Assessor’s website (www.saa.gov.uk) the subjects have a Rateable Value of £10,200 effective 1st April 2023. UTILITIES The property is served by mains electricity, gas and water ENERGY PERFORMANCE CERTIFICATE The Energy Performance Certificate rating is pending. A copy of the recommendation report is available on request. ENTRY Upon completion of a formal missive under Scots Law. LEGAL COSTS Each party shall bear their own legal costs with the eventual tenant liable for any LBTT and Registration Dues. What use class do EH7 shops to rent fall under?
Retail properties generally fall under Use Class E (formerly A1), which includes shops, showrooms, cafes, hairdressers, and some financial services. This offers flexibility for occupiers, but always confirm local planning rules with the local authority.
What types of retail units are available in EH7?
Retail spaces available range from high street shops, corner units, and parade shops to shopping centre units, kiosks, and destination retail in leisure or outlet parks. Units vary in size, frontage, and footfall exposure.
What should I consider before renting a retail unit?
Key considerations include location, target customer base, footfall, frontage, accessibility, loading/delivery access, planning use, lease flexibility, and nearby occupiers. It’s also essential to factor in service charges, business rates, and fit-out costs.
What is typically included in a retail lease?
A standard lease outlines rent, term length, service charges, repair obligations, permitted use, and break clauses. Most leases are full repairing and insuring (FRI), meaning the tenant is responsible for upkeep and insurance costs unless negotiated otherwise.
Do I need planning permission to change the use of a shop?
Possibly. Many retail properties now fall under Use Class E, which allows greater flexibility. However, if you're changing to a takeaway (sui generis), clinic, or residential, planning permission may be required. Always check with the local planning authority.
Are business rates included in shop rents?
No. Business rates are a separate cost, unless the lease is all-inclusive. Small businesses may qualify for Small Business Rate Relief (SBRR), which can significantly reduce or eliminate rates payable depending on the property's rateable value.
Can I sublet or assign my retail lease?
This depends on your lease terms. Some agreements allow subletting or lease assignment with the landlord’s consent. It’s important to confirm this upfront if flexibility is a priority for your business.
